◿ Read Kindle @Go Systems Programming: Master Linux and Unix system level programming with Go ♁ By Mihalis Tsoukalos ♠

◿ Read Kindle @Go Systems Programming: Master Linux and Unix system level programming with Go ♁ By Mihalis Tsoukalos ♠ ◿ Read Kindle @Go Systems Programming: Master Linux and Unix system level programming with Go ♁ By Mihalis Tsoukalos ♠ Key FeaturesLearn how to write system s level code in Golang, similar to Unix Linux systems codeRamp up in Go quicklyDeep dive into Goroutines and Go concurrency to be able to take advantage of Go server level constructsBook DescriptionGo is the new systems programming language for Linux and Unix systems It is also the language in which some of the most prominent cloud level systems have been written, such as Docker Where C programmers used to rule, Go programmers are in demand to write highly optimized systems programming code.Created by some of the original designers of C and Unix, Go expands the systems programmers toolkit and adds a mature, clear programming language Traditional system applications become easier to write since pointers are not relevant and garbage collection has taken away the most problematic area for low level systems code memory management.This book opens up the world of high performance Unix system applications to the beginning Go programmer It does not get stuck on single systems or even system types, but tries to expand the original teachings from Unix system level programming to all types of servers, the cloud, and the web.What you will learnExplore the Go language from the standpoint of a developer conversant with Unix, Linux, and so onUnderstand Goroutines, the lightweight threads used for systems and concurrent applicationsLearn how to translate Unix and Linux systems code in C to Golang codeHow to write fast and lightweight server codeDive into concurrency with GoWrite low level networking codeAbout the AuthorMihalis Tsoukalos is a Unix administrator, programmer, DBA, and mathematician, who enjoys writing technical books and articles and learning new things He has written than 250 technical articles for many magazines including Sys Admin, MacTech, Linux User and Developer, USENIX login , Linux Format, and Linux Journal His research interests include databases, operating systems, Statistics, and machine learning.He is also the technical editor for MongoDB in Action, Second Edition, published by Manning.Table of ContentsGetting Started with Go and Unix Systems Programming Writing programs in Go Advanced Go Features Go Packages, Algorithms, and Data Structures Files and Directories File Input and Output Working with System Files Processes and Signals Goroutines Basic Features Goroutines Advance Features Writing Web Applications in Go Network Programming Go programming language Wikipedia Go often referred to as Golang is a designed by Google engineers Robert Griesemer, Rob Pike, and Ken Thompson statically typed, compiled in the tradition of C, with added benefits memory safety, garbage collection, structural typing, CSP style concurrency The compiler, tools, source code are all free open The Programming Language an that makes it easy build simple, reliable, efficient software Hours, Sams Teach Yourself Next Generation Systems George Ornbo on FREE shipping qualifying offers Language Blog Portable Cloud July Introduction Today, team at releasing new project, Cloud, library tools for developing cloudWith this we aim make Touch N Systems, Inc Corporate Home Page Advertising information See our Rate Card advertising websites We encourage you contact us if have any questions, comments or suggestions regarding web site always interested related links might benefit users Thanks visiting, updated regularly so come back RT Radio Software Control Cloning Ham For over years, RT has produced radio top amateur manufacturers John P Baugh s caused lot excitement As modern systems language, significant advantages older languages like C , Java Industrial Automation Process Water Industrial Automation, Contamination Monitoring, Centurion Controls improve performance quality control Compile run Programs Create your own fully featured programs Really understand how computers work, what develop Mastering production Mihalis Tsoukalos, accomplished author, his previous book Programming, become must read Unix Linux professionalWhen not writing books, he spends working life, administrator, programmer, DBA, mathematician who enjoys technical articles Active FTP vs Passive FTP, Definitive Explanation Apache Documents Solaris TechNotes Other Technical Docs Humour Logos Active Live Online Training Safari Books Online Live Get intensive, hands training critical technology, design, business topics, led instructors from O Reilly unparalleled network tech innovators expert practitioners, trusted partners List Greek Americans following list notable Americans, including both original immigrants descent obtained American citizenship their descendants Go Systems Programming: Master Linux and Unix system level programming with Go


    • Go Systems Programming: Master Linux and Unix system level programming with Go
    • 4.4
    • 604
    • Kindle
    • 466 pages
    • 1787125645
    • Mihalis Tsoukalos
    • English
    • 02 March 2017

Leave a Reply

Your email address will not be published. Required fields are marked *